We walked a little ways to Sally Lunn's. It's in the oldest house in Bath. Occupied since the 1400's, Sally Lunn moved in 1690 and started baking her famous buns. Today they still make the buns and serve them with all kinds of things. Of course we got there at a peak time and our 7-person group had to split (no biggie). Abby, Laura, and I ended up in the Jane Austen Room (!). We all got cream tea, which was brilliant! I got the Jane Austen Cream Tea which consisted of tea and a half a Sally Lunn bun with raspberry jam and clotted cream. It was so big I couldn't finish it, although I had three cups of tea.
